FAQ - Iron Removal Plant for Schools & Colleges
Why do schools and colleges need an iron removal plant?
Iron-contaminated water affects drinking safety, hygiene, and the life of plumbing systems. Installing an iron removal plant ensures students and staff have access to clean, odor-free, and iron-free water, which is crucial for health, cooking, labs, and sanitation.
What problems does iron in water cause in educational institutions?
High iron levels can lead to:
Reddish-brown stains in toilets and sinks.
Foul metallic smell and taste.
Pipe clogging and corrosion.
Reduced efficiency of water heaters and filters.
Discolored uniforms and utensils in hostels and canteens.
What type of iron removal system is suitable for schools?
A centralized iron removal plant with high flow rate and backwashable filters is ideal. Systems may include pressure sand filters, manganese dioxide media, or advanced oxidation units depending on iron levels and water usage.
How is the plant installed in schools or colleges?
The plant is installed at the source or overhead tank inlet to treat all incoming water. Water Sparks provides turnkey installation, including water testing, plant design, plumbing, and electrical work.
What capacity iron removal plant is recommended for schools?
The size depends on student strength and daily water usage. Common models range from 1000 LPH to 5000 LPH. A site inspection and water test are usually done to determine the ideal capacity.
